Salesforce Install & Setup
How to install Champify’s Salesforce package, and the settings needed to ensure Champify can properly operate in your CRM. Not all items require action.
Overview
- Install Salesforce Package
- Create Salesforce Integration User for Champify
- User Permissions
- Duplicate Rules
- Lead Source Picklist
- Contact & Lead Page Layouts
- Custom Field for “Past Account Name”
- Enable Bounce Management
Install Salesforce Package
Before you install, confirm field limits
- Upon installation, Champify’s managed package adds a number of custom fields to your standard Salesforce objects. Here is the full list.
- While it is uncommon to exceed Salesforce’s custom field limits, it is a best practice to confirm your Salesforce has sufficient space for additional custom fields before installation.
Please note that:
- Installation alone will not automatically enable any functions or automations.
- Champify will never overwrite, delete, or modify your existing CRM data.
- Before any Champify jobs run, Champify’s Apex Governor checks your Salesforce limits (storage, API calls, async apex) and won’t run if you are too close to those limits.
Installation Instructions:
- Sign into Salesforce: login.salesforce.com
- Install Champify with our one-click installer: go.champify.io/install
- Select “Install for All Users”
- Click “Install”
- Grant access to “api.champify.io”
- Click “Continue”
- Install typically takes between 2-20 minutes. When complete, you’ll receive an email from Salesforce.
Create Salesforce Integration User for Champify
To ensure the Champify jobs consistently run independent of attrition, please set up a Salesforce Integration User for the Champify app.
Ensure proper Salesforce permissions
Under Salesforce settings, apply the “Champify Administrator” permission set to your user. Additionally, ensure that your user profile has access to view and edit standard fields on standard objects.
Review Duplicate Rules
Background:
- Salesforce’s “standard” duplicate rules can mistake 2 contacts with the same name as being duplicates, and can block Champify from operating.
Instructions:
- If the SFDC standard duplicate rules are active on contacts or leads, you must edit the rule with a condition that states “only run if” “is a champify” = FALSE.
Add “Champify” to your Lead Source Picklist
Instructions:
- Settings → Objects → Lead → Fields & Relationships → Lead Source → Add picklist value → “Champify”
- If you also use Champify’s Calendar Sync product, it is also a best practice to add a separate picklist value for “Champify - Calendar Sync”
- Repeat for contacts
Add Champify fields to contact, lead and account page layouts
Instructions:
- Settings → Objects → Contacts → Page Layouts → Select Page Layout → Add “Champify” section → drag & drop the below fields under the section → save
- Repeat this same process with leads — *only relevant if you use lead objects in Salesforce
Add Champify Explorer to the SFDC Nav Bar
Background:
The primary location for reps to review their Champify records is via Champify Explorer. This is a custom experience hosted within Salesforce.
Add the tab to the Salesforce Navigation Bar. Within Salesforce: “Edit” pen icon → “Add More Items” → “New” → Search and select “Champify” → Drop up to the top of the list —> “Save”
Further information on Champify Explorer: Champify Explorer documentation
Create new field for “Past Account Name”
Background:
- While Champify includes a lookup to “Past Account” on both contacts and leads, tools like Outreach and Salesloft default to displaying the account ID instead of the account name.
- So, instead of mapping the lookup field to the corresponding custom field in Outreach or Salesloft, we’ll create then map a new field.
Instructions: video here
- Settings → objects → contact → fields and relationships → new field → formula → text type → input the formula below → mark as visible → do not add to contact or lead layout pages
- ChampifyIo__Past_Account__r.ChampifyIo__cleanName__c
- *needed on contacts, or leads, or both… depending on which objects you configure Champify to manage*
Enable Bounce Management
We recommend enabling bounce management in Salesforce to flag bounced emails.
Live Walkthrough
Last updated on May 7, 2024